当前位置:首页 > 科技动态 > 正文

ssh 使用什么做权限管理

ssh 使用什么做权限管理

SSH权限管理:如何高效利用权限控制保障安全SSH(Secure Shell)是一种网络协议,用于计算机之间的安全通信和数据传输。在SSH中,权限管理是确保网络安全的关...

SSH权限管理:如何高效利用权限控制保障安全

SSH(Secure Shell)是一种网络协议,用于计算机之间的安全通信和数据传输。在SSH中,权限管理是确保网络安全的关键环节。以下是一些关于SSH权限管理的常见问题及其解答,帮助您更好地理解和应用SSH权限控制。

问题一:SSH权限管理中,常见的权限控制方法有哪些?

SSH权限管理主要通过以下几种方法实现:

  • 用户认证:通过密码、密钥对等方式对用户进行身份验证。
  • 用户权限:设置用户对特定文件的访问权限,包括读取、写入、执行等。
  • 用户角色:将用户分组,为不同角色分配不同的权限。
  • SSH密钥管理:使用SSH密钥对代替密码,提高安全性。

问题二:如何使用SSH密钥对进行权限管理?

使用SSH密钥对进行权限管理,需要按照以下步骤操作:

  1. 将公钥上传到服务器:将公钥上传到服务器的授权目录中。
  2. 配置服务器:在服务器上配置SSH服务,允许使用密钥对进行认证。
  3. 客户端连接:使用私钥进行SSH连接,无需输入密码。

使用SSH密钥对进行权限管理,可以提高安全性,防止密码泄露。同时,密钥对的管理需要谨慎,避免私钥泄露。

问题三:如何设置SSH用户权限,限制对特定文件的访问?

设置SSH用户权限,限制对特定文件的访问,可以通过以下步骤实现:

  1. 创建用户:在服务器上创建需要限制访问的用户。
  2. 设置用户权限:为用户设置只读、只写或执行权限。
  3. 配置SSH访问:在SSH配置文件中设置用户访问权限,例如禁止访问特定目录。
  4. 验证设置:尝试以用户身份连接服务器,验证权限设置是否生效。

通过设置SSH用户权限,可以有效地限制用户对特定文件的访问,提高安全性。

问题四:如何使用SSH用户角色进行权限管理?

使用SSH用户角色进行权限管理,可以按照以下步骤操作:

  1. 创建角色:在SSH配置文件中创建角色,定义角色的权限。
  2. 分配用户到角色:将用户分配到相应的角色。
  3. 配置SSH访问:为角色设置访问权限,例如允许访问特定目录。
  4. 验证设置:尝试以用户身份连接服务器,验证角色权限设置是否生效。

使用SSH用户角色进行权限管理,可以方便地对多个用户进行权限控制,提高管理效率。

问题五:如何定期检查SSH服务器权限设置,确保安全性?

定期检查SSH服务器权限设置,确保安全性,可以采取以下措施:

  • 定期审计:定期对SSH服务器进行安全审计,检查权限设置是否符合要求。
  • 监控日志:监控SSH服务器的日志,及时发现异常登录行为。
  • 更新密钥:定期更新SSH密钥,避免密钥泄露。
  • 备份配置:定期备份SSH配置文件,以便在出现问题时快速恢复。

通过定期检查SSH服务器权限设置,可以及时发现并解决安全隐患,提高系统安全性。

最新文章